Common Causes of Car Accidents
Several factors contribute to car accidents in Citrus Heights:
Distracted Driving: Texting or using mobile devices while driving is one of the leading causes. Speeding: Exceeding speed limits increases the severity of collisions. Driving Under the Influence (DUI): Alcohol or drug impairment can impair judgment significantly. Weather Conditions: Rain or fog can affect visibility and road traction.Understanding these causes can help drivers become more cautious on the roads.
Common Injuries Resulting from Car Accidents
Types of Injuries Sustained in Car Accidents
Victims of car accidents in Citrus Heights often face various injuries:
- Whiplash: A common neck injury caused by sudden changes in velocity. Fractures: Broken bones can occur due to impact during a crash. Traumatic Brain Injuries (TBI): Can result from hitting one's head against hard surfaces. Spinal Cord Injuries: These may lead to paralysis or chronic pain.
Each type of injury comes with its own set of challenges regarding treatment and recovery.

Understanding Liability Issues
Liability determines who is at fault:
Comparative Negligence Laws apply; even if you’re partially at fault, you may still recover damages based on your percentage of fault. It’s vital to establish clear liability through police reports or witness statements.

Compensation Types Available for Victims
Economic Damages Explained
Economic damages cover tangible losses incurred due to an accident including:
- Medical expenses Lost wages Property damage costs
These are quantifiable losses that directly impact your finances post-accident.
Non-Economic Damages Explained
Non-economic damages address more subjective losses such as:
Pain and suffering Emotional distress Loss of enjoyment of lifeCalculating these damages often requires expert testimony or detailed documentation regarding quality-of-life changes post-injury.

3. What is comparative negligence?
Comparative negligence allows compensation even when you're partially at fault! If determined that you share some responsibility for causing an accident—compensation may still be awarded proportionately based on degree attributed!
4. How long do I have to file my claim after an accident?
In California—generally you have two years from date-of-injury—this statute encompasses most personal injury claims! Missing this deadline may jeopardize ability to seek compensation!
